    Farm to Market Road 2611 (FM 2611) is 13.387-mile (21.544 km) state road in Brazoria and Matagorda counties. FM 2611 begins where FM 2004 ends at SH 36 near Jones Creek . The road follows a western path, crossing the San Bernard River and passing the Churchill Bridge Community.

    U.S. Route 290 (US 290) is an east–west U.S. Highway located entirely within the state of Texas.Its western terminus is at Interstate 10 southeast of Segovia, and its eastern terminus is at Interstate 610 in northwest Houston. [1]
